In today’s competitive market, understanding your customers’ journey is crucial for delivering exceptional experiences that foster loyalty and drive conversions. Customer journey mapping is a powerful tool that helps marketers visualize and optimize the entire customer experience from initial awareness to post-purchase engagement. In this blog post, we will delve into the concept of customer journey mapping, its benefits, and practical steps to create and implement an effective customer journey map.

What is Customer Journey Mapping?

Customer journey mapping is the process of creating a visual representation of the customer’s interactions with a brand across various touchpoints. It provides insights into the customers’ needs, emotions, and behaviours at each stage of their journey, enabling businesses to identify pain points and opportunities for improvement. By mapping out the customer journey, brands can create more personalized and cohesive experiences that resonate with their audience.

Benefits of Customer Journey Mapping

1. Enhanced Customer Understanding: A customer journey map helps businesses gain a deeper understanding of their customers’ motivations, preferences, and pain points. This knowledge is essential for crafting targeted marketing strategies and delivering relevant content.

2. Improved Customer Experience: By identifying friction points and areas where customers may experience frustration, brands can take proactive steps to enhance the overall experience. This leads to increased customer satisfaction and loyalty.

3. Increased Conversion Rates: Optimizing the customer journey can lead to higher conversion rates by ensuring that customers receive the right message at the right time. A seamless journey reduces drop-offs and encourages customers to move forward in the sales funnel.

4. Better Alignment Across Teams: A customer journey map serves as a valuable communication tool that aligns marketing, sales, and customer service teams. It provides a shared understanding of the customer’s experience, fostering collaboration and consistency.

5. Data-Driven Decision Making: Journey maps are based on data and insights, allowing businesses to make informed decisions. This data-driven approach ensures that marketing strategies are grounded in customer behaviour and preferences.

Steps to Create an Effective Customer Journey Map

1. Define Your Objectives

Before diving into the creation of a journey map, it’s important to define your objectives. What do you hope to achieve with this map? Are you looking to improve customer satisfaction, increase conversion rates, or streamline the onboarding process? Clear objectives will guide your mapping process and ensure that your efforts are focused on achieving specific goals.

2. Identify Customer Personas

Customer personas are fictional representations of your ideal customers. They are based on real data and insights about your target audience. Identify the key personas that represent different segments of your customer base. This will help you tailor the journey map to the unique needs and behaviours of each persona.

3. Gather Data and Insights

Collect data from various sources to gain a comprehensive understanding of your customers’ journey. This includes website analytics, customer surveys, feedback forms, social media interactions, and customer support logs. Qualitative data, such as customer interviews and focus groups, can provide valuable insights into the emotions and motivations behind customer actions.

4. Identify Touchpoints

Touchpoints are the various interactions customers have with your brand throughout their journey. These can include website visits, social media interactions, email communications, in-store visits, and customer service calls. List all the touchpoints relevant to your customers’ journey and categorize them into different stages.

5. Map the Current Journey

Create a visual representation of the current customer journey for each persona. This can be done using a flowchart, diagram, or specialized journey mapping software. Highlight the key touchpoints, actions, emotions, and pain points at each stage of the journey. This map will serve as a baseline for identifying areas of improvement.

6. Analyse Pain Points and Opportunities

Review the current journey map to identify pain points and areas where customers may experience frustration or confusion. These could be long response times, complicated checkout processes, or lack of personalized communication. Additionally, look for opportunities to enhance the experience, such as providing more relevant content or offering proactive support.

7. Design the Ideal Journey

Based on the insights gathered, design the ideal customer journey for each persona. Focus on creating a seamless and enjoyable experience that addresses pain points and leverages opportunities. Consider the emotions and motivations of customers at each stage and ensure that your messaging and interactions are aligned with their needs.

8. Implement Changes

Once you have designed the ideal journey, implement the necessary changes across your marketing, sales, and customer service channels. This may involve updating your website, refining your email campaigns, improving customer support processes, or enhancing your social media strategy. Ensure that all teams are aligned and aware of the changes being made.

9. Monitor and Iterate

Customer journey mapping is an ongoing process. Continuously monitor the effectiveness of the changes you have implemented by tracking key metrics such as customer satisfaction, conversion rates, and engagement levels. Gather feedback from customers to identify any new pain points or areas for improvement. Use this data to iterate and refine your journey map over time.

Best Practices for Customer Journey Mapping

  • Empathy is Key: Put yourself in your customers’ shoes and try to understand their emotions and motivations. Empathy will help you create a more human-centric journey map that resonates with your audience.
  • Collaborate Across Teams: Involve representatives from different departments in the mapping process. This ensures that you capture diverse perspectives and create a holistic view of the customer journey.
  • Keep it Simple: While it’s important to capture detailed information, avoid making the journey map overly complex. Keep it simple and easy to understand for all stakeholders.
  • Use Visuals: Visual elements such as icons, colours, and diagrams can make the journey map more engaging and easier to comprehend. Use visuals to highlight key touchpoints and emotions.
  • Stay Customer-Focused: Always keep the customer at the centre of your journey mapping efforts. The ultimate goal is to enhance the customer experience, so ensure that every decision is made with the customer in mind.


Customer journey mapping is a powerful tool that helps businesses understand and optimize the customer experience. By visualizing the journey from the customer’s perspective, brands can identify pain points, improve interactions, and create more personalized experiences. Implementing an effective customer journey map requires a deep understanding of your audience, collaboration across teams, and a commitment to continuous improvement. By following the steps and best practices outlined in this guide, you can enhance your marketing strategies and drive greater customer satisfaction and loyalty.